Indie and proud of it, Collective Soul are closing in on sales of 200,000 with their sixth studio album YOUTH, released on the band’s own El Music Group. Following the top 5 success of “Counting The Days” on the Mainstream Rock chart, the band’s new single “Better Now” had a Top 5 chart position on Triple A radio and is currently surging into the Top Ten on the Hot AC chart. Death Cab For Cutie's new album, titled Plans, will be in stores August 30th. It was once again produced, recorded, and mixed by DCFC's very own Chris Walla and contains 11 songs (see track listing in comments).
